WebUSE LAMAs? • Do not use a LAMA if you have glaucoma or are at risk of urinary retention. • If you have uncontrolled persistent asthma, talk with your health care provider about the … WebUsing a LABA. Long-acting beta-agonist (LABA) are a type of bronchodilator medicine. Bronchodilator medicine opens the airways in the lungs by relaxing smooth muscle around the airways. LABA are also long-term control medicines. This means they are taken every day to maintain control and prevent symptoms of coughing, wheezing, chest tightness ...

DPIs contain a sealed dose of dry powder in a capsule or disk. The inhaler mechanism pierces the capsule and the user sucks the powder straight into the lungs through the mouth. The potential interaction between beta-blockers and beta-agonists is a classic example of a pharmacodynamic drug interaction.
